Poon Hill trekking leads you on top above a view-point at 3,210 m and 10,531ft high where you face stunning panorama of world three highest mountains from Dhaulagiri the 7th world highest with Annapurna the 10th high and Manaslu 8th highest with range of lesser peaks along with striking sunrise.
Poon Hill trekking an enjoyable high green hill country walks of less than a week duration or even shorter of 3-4 days depending upon your choice and interest that can be extended within a week time frame.
Poon Hill Trekking a fabulous moderate adventure located within beautiful serene rhododendron woodland with pines and magnolia trees, in spring the whole areas turns into natural garden when wild flowers are in full bloom from March till the month of May.
Poon Hill Trekking a high hill above lovely scenic Ghorepani village populated by hill people known as Poon of Magar tribes famous as brave Gorkha soldiers in foreign legion UK and in India army.
This short and marvelous walk starts from scenic Pokhara city a popular touristic spot within Himalaya blessed with natural beauty of mountains and serene lakes, where walk leads from low warm farm areas to mid-hills within cooler alpine areas covered with dense forest.
All along the walks with climb to reach winding gradual path towards Ghorepani village located 2880m and 9,448 ft offers grand views of Dhaulagiri range of mountains with Annapurna peaks.
Morning an hour hike uphill takes you on top Poon Hill for sweeping mountain panorama with stunning sunrise views, after a grand scenic moment head back to picturesque Pokhara either taking the same route down-hill or using an alternative trail through Tadapani and large Ghandruk Gurung village to reach back at beautiful Pokhara, after fabulous time and experience on Poon Hill Trekking.
